The National Monuments Service's description
In level partially waterlogged pasture, on E side of stream. Enclosure, visible as circular cropmark on aerial photograph (LAS), now evident as sub-rectangular area (13m N-S; 16m E-W) defined by earthen bank (int. H 0.3m; ext. H 0.55m) with external fosse (Wth 4m; D 0.2m). The enclosing element is barely traceable on the S side; fosse most evident at SW.
